[Libya] CARIM: Law n°19 of 2010 related to the combating of irregular migration, 23/01/2010

The main points of these laws are:

- The law contains 14 articles.

- The law shows 5 acts that constitutes illegal migration (art. 2).

- The law contain penalties of: fine, misdemeanor, crime. The crime can reach as much as life imprisonment (art. 3,4,5,6,7).

- The illegal migrant can be punished for imprisonment of a misdemeanor, plus a fine of not less then one thousand Libyan dinars. In all cases he should be deported after his penalty ends (Art. 5).

- All foreigners residing in Libya should legalize their stay in Libya within a period of 2 months starting from the sate of entry into force of this law, otherwise they are to be considered as illegal migrants and they will be subject to penalties of this law (art. 11).
